What is a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C)?

• Established to increase the availability of primary and preventive health care services for low-income people living in medically underserved areas (safety net provider)

• Qualifying funding under Section 330 of the Public Health Service Act (PHS)

• Health Centers make up about $26.3 billion in revenue (Medicaid, Medicare, private insurance, and Federal and State grants)

• 1,373 Health Centers nation wide (~11,000 physical sites)

• Number of patients served 27.2 million

Who is Lone Star Circle of Care?• Lone Star Circle of Care (LSCC) is an integrated primary

and behavioral health care provider that also offers care coordination and access to specialty care

• LSCC was founded in 2001 in Georgetown, Texas, as a single clinic, and it has grown into a large clinical system with 21 physical locations in 6 counties

• LSCC is a private 501(c)(3) non-profit entity with the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) designation; community health center

Budgeting Process –not so much fun• Multiple linked spreadsheets by location

• Approximately 130 linked Excel workbooks to provide summary analysis via pivot tables

• Had to remember to refresh often• Manual process to add new locations and accounts• Excel is not perfect and links would break often and

would take days to relink various workbooks• Limited time for analysis – board package was always

rushed• Spent entire time linking workbooks and maintenance of

the process• Don’t forget to run formatting Macros

Industry Specific Issues…

• Budgeting at the employee level• Providers are the drivers of revenue• Support staff for those providers is the primary driver

of expense• 68% of opex is comprised of salary & burden

• Provider turnover can have a huge impact on revenue

• Many employees split time between clinics and/or service lines

• Revenue inputs are specific to clinics• Provider productivity• Payer mix• Payer rates• Seasonality
